Roadmap for Sustainable Analytics
A clear roadmap aligns initiatives, timelines, and responsibilities so analytics efforts do not lose momentum. Focusing on quick wins, cultural change, and scalable foundations supports long term value.
- Clarify strategic objectives and success criteria
- Map current data sources and gaps
- Pilot high impact use cases with cross functional teams
- Standardize metrics, dashboards, and data quality rules
- Scale tools, training, and governance across the organization
- Iterate based on user feedback and evolving business needs

How does Dee Blalock define decision latency and why does it matter?
Decision latency measures the time between data availability and action taken. Lower latency means faster response to market changes, reduced risk exposure, and more efficient resource use.
What are common pitfalls when rolling out a performance measurement framework?
Common pitfalls include misaligned incentives, inconsistent definitions, too many metrics, and lack of follow up. Clear ownership and staged adoption help mitigate these risks.
